Access でこのような一連のクエリを正常に実行できますが、MS SQL でそれらをビューまたはストアド プロシージャにしようとすると、サブクエリのエイリアスが後でクエリで使用する有効な列ではないことがわかります。計算を実行します。
これが私がAccessに持っているものです:
SELECT T.DistrictNum,
(select count(winner) from TournyGames2013 where type='Pool 1' and winner=T.DistrictNum) AS TeamWins,
(select count(loser) from TournyGames2013 where type='Pool 1' and loser=T.DistrictNum) AS TeamLoses,
([TeamWins]+[TeamLoses]) AS GameTotal
FROM TournyTeams2013 AS T
WHERE T.Pool=1
どうすれば、これから機能するビューまたはストアドプロシージャを作成できますか?
ありがとう、優しくして、ここに私の最初の投稿。